Upon entering the Prairie, lead Dart and the group along the path away from the pursuing Wardens. Lavitz will be struck in the leg by a stray arrow and Dart and Shana will help him take cover in the brush on the next screen eluding their captors.
Back in control of Dart, return southeast to the previous screen and walk southeast again, under a stone overhang, to find a semi-hidden chest containing 100 Gold. Back the way you came, the northeast exit, later on in the game, will take you back toward the Forest and Seles, but is inaccessible. For now, exit to the west and have Dart examine the rushing flow of water, then return and take the southern exit. Here, the party will find a simple shack and a seemingly abandoned horse. For the moment, don't enter the shack, but take the northwest exit and have Dart examine the tree that is leaning over the river below there.
Return to the shack area, but right before the entrance, search for a hidden treasure chest on the lower-left side to obtain a Total Vanishing item. Total Vanishing is an item that attempts to instantly kill an enemy and can never be purchased, but will be available as a drop from several monster encounters.
Inside the shack, Lavitz will take a rest while Shana applies some first aid to his wound. Shana will ask Dart about his activities for the past five years he has been away from Seles. He will tell the story of how an entity known as the Black Monster destroyed his former home of Neet, while killing his family in the process. Now, only holding his Father's Stone as a memento, he has been traveling the world seeking revenge on the Monster. Lavitz will suggest that the group travel with him to Bale and consult with Minister Noish about the Black Monster.
When the scene is over, if Dart has examined the stream and tree from the previous locations, you can pick up the Ax From the Shack item; you can also use the chair inside the shack as a makeshift inn to restore your party. Take the axe back northwest of the shack and Dart will chop down the tree creating a way to cross the stream below. Return to the center area where you hid from the Hellena Wardens, and cross the stream to the west via the fallen tree.
Past the stream, take a nearby treasure to the north containing an Angel's Prayer and speak with the family nearby. Lavitz will invite the displaced Sandorian family to live with him and his mother back in Bale. While there is no tangible reward for this, it makes for a feel good story later in the game. Continue taking the path west and back out to the world map, then north to our next dungeon: the Limestone Cave. Right upon entering the dungeon, snatch the treasure for a Detonate Rock item. Like talked about in the previous chapter, Detonate Rocks are rare, but relatively ineffective, magic items. Besides this one, you can only find these through enemy drops; of which only two monsters in the game carry them.
Move Dart south, not crossing the land-bridge, and look for an action icon to pop up along the edge of the water run-off. Use it to skip across the rocks to a treasure chest containing a Healing Potion. Afterwards, cross the bridge and exit to the southwest.
This area is a bit maze-like with multiple paths Dart can slide down depending on the direction you are holding when he gets close to an intersection. Enter the one directly south of the start of the room and don't press any directional buttons; it will automatically take you to a chest containing 20 Gold. Climb back to the top of the water slide and use it again, but this time hold up, then right, to take the correct turns down to the treasure with a new weapon for Dart: the Bastard Sword. Note: If you're playing the PAL version, this will be called Long Sword. With these two chests opened, you can exit to the south.
With Shana and Lavitz following behind, you need to hop around the stepping stones in the following area. The two easily-found chests in the room contain a Total Vanishing and Body Purifier. As you attempt to exit south, Dart will save Lavitz from falling and a small, friendship scene will ensue.
In the next room, in the above screenshot, Dart can walk through here to another part of the dungeon and pick up 100 Gold in a chest. Back out, look for the glowing light area to the southeast. Dart and Lavitz explain that these are rock fireflies and they will instantly restore your party like an inn. After the explanation, climb the rocks north to find two chests with an Angel's Prayer and Burn Out inside, followed by taking the southeastern exit. Here: climb the limestone shelf and use the northern path.
You'll be in the area below where you found the 100G treasure, with a...I dunno what, hopping around. Raid the chest to the left-side for a Spark Net item, then to reveal the other treasure, you'll need to catch the creature. It can be tricky, but you can use the lower stepping stones to gain an advantage while, the creature moves to the left-side on the outside rocks, Dart uses the inside ones to gain ground. Once caught, it will drop another chest where you will find a Poison Guard accessory. Go ahead and equip this on either Dart of Lavitz. Note: The Ugly Balloon enemy in this dungeon has an extremely rare chance to drop additional Poison Guard accessories, but you will be able to purchase them soon, and it's not really worth your time. If you happen to get an extra one, it can't hurt, however. Back outside the stepping stone room, move around the outside rock path to the east; grabbing a Charm Potion on the way.
Continue to make your way through the linear path until you reach an open room with a save point. Moving toward the glowing pillar, pick up a Body Purifier chest, then one containing a Bandana just beyond it. This Bandana and the one Dart has equipped are the only two of these helmets in the game, so make sure if you're an item collector to keep at least one. Also, save your game as a boss fight is just around the corner.
The Urobolus stands in the way of our heros reaching Bale. The only thing to concern yourself with here is the potential to be inflicted with the poison status. You found two Body Purifiers in the dungeon, and either Dart or Lavitz should have the Poison Guard accessory equipped, so you should be fine. Dart with Volcano and Lavitz using Spinning Cane is plenty of offense, coupled with Shana throwing magic items at it. Once it's taken enough damage, it will take refuge in a hallowed-out area of the wall and only Shana's attack and magic will reach it. At this point, have Lavitz defend, Shana attack, and Dart use magic items until it returns to its previous position. For winning, the party will obtain a Wargod's Amulet accessory, that increases both physical and magical hit percentages and is the first of only two of this accessory. Since Lavitz already has the Sallet helmet equipped, which provides a small hit% boost, go ahead and give this accessory to Dart and saddle Lavitz with the Poison Guard.
The serpent was thought to be dead after Dart's attack, but it will manage to slither one last attack on Shana, only to be disintegrated by a dazzling light coming from her forehead. Ominous. Follow the straight-forward path out of the remainder of the Limestone Cave, landing two chests with a Healing Potion and 50G inside on your way to the world map near the capital of Bale.
Right outside of Bale, on the world map, you can encounter your first "special" monster: the Yellow Bird. These types of enemies are scattered throughout the world and are a great source of either EXP, Gold, rare items, or a combination of the three. The only problem is: not only is their evasion great, but they love to flee, and attacks only deal 1 damage, no matter what. I'll cover these on an individual bases as we can encounter them. The Yellow Bird only has 4 HP, but you'll soon find that hitting it four times before it decides to run is a tremendous pain. Thankfully, Shana already has good accuracy, while Lavitz has the Sallet helmet, and Dart can equip the Wargod's Amulet for increases accuracy. Later, we'll be able to apply different strategies, but for now, you're just going to need luck on your side. Oh, and in case you were wondering, using a Total Vanishing is not an option.
Vanquishing a Yellow Bird will net the party a nice 300 Gold, and if you're lucky, the Elude Cloak accessory. This is an outstanding piece of equipment that boosts your physical evasion by 20%. MUCH later in the game you can purchase this, so it is not a necessity to get, but very nice to have. If you manage to get one, save it for the next joining character and keep Shana with the Knight Shield.
Phew, there's a lot going on in the Capital of Bale, our first major city, so you'll need to follow along closely. Enter the first house on the left and open the crate to pocket 50G, then speak with the little girl. She'll paint a portrait of Lavitz that adds the Lavitz's Picture item to your inventory. This item is only available for a limited time, and is missable, so make sure to pick it up as soon as you can.
Back out on the main street, head north, past the fountain, and into the bar/inn. Talk to the bartender and agree to pay 100 Gold to nab the Good Spirits item. You probably need it, but don't stay at the inn yet; we'll get a free rest before we leave.
Leaving the inn, continue east to find the item shop. Spear Frost is one of my personal favorite attack items, and will be useful for a boss a little later on, so you might consider a couple of them. Meteor Fall can also be extremely useful for a major boss that is upcoming; especially if you'll be using Shana consistently.
From the item shop, ignore the path leading north, for now, and use the western exit, past the inn, to reach the town's bazaar. Enter the building to the northeast, with the skull and crossbones-looking insignia over the door, and search the display of spears in the lower portion to find your second piece of Stardust.
This is the first armory of the game and we can upgrade some of our character's equipment. Pick up a Scale Armor and a Sallet helmet for Dart, but don't waste any Gold on the Sparkle Arrow or any of the accessories; we'll find all of these in treasure chests in the next portion of the game. If you've got some extra Gold, you may consider adding a third Sallet to your inventory, which could be useful in dealing with enemies like the Yellow Bird later on. Personally, now that Dart has a Sallet, I moved the Wargod's Amulet accessory over to Lavitz and gave Dart the Poison Guard. There's an alleyway to the right of the armory where you can find a bookstore and a clinic. There's nothing tangible at either place, but the clinic can recover status effects for you and the bookstore has some useful tidbits on the history of Endiness.
Exit north from the bazaar to enter Indels Castle's courtyard. Use the left-most exit to find the soldier's barracks and a nearby chest with the Sparkle Arrow weapon for Shana in it.
In the northeast of the barracks, search the blacksmith's forge to find another piece of Stardust, then climb the stairs near the crates to the east.
On the second floor of the Castle now, descend the ladder to your left, then yet another ladder, to reach an underground port area. Have Dart use the wheel on the wall to open two passages below, then return up the ladders.
In the lower-left, bedroom portion of the second floor, look for a treasure containing 50G, then climb the stairs to the third floor.
Search the musical instrument in the upper-left corner of the third floor to pocket another piece of Stardust. In the right-hand-side room you can find a chest containing 100 Gold.
The southwestern room of the third floor contains an exit you need to enter from the right that takes you outside onto a terrace and to the lower-right side of the third floor. Descend the ladder and open the chest containing the Active Ring accessory that defends against the dispiriting status.
Return the way you came and climb the stairs in the lower-center portion of the third floor to meet the King of Serdio, Albert. He'll be overjoyed to see that his lifelong friend Lavitz has returned alive. He'll thank Dart for his efforts at Hellena and offer to help them in any way. He wants to leave Shana here, to protect her from Sandora, but she will steadfastly refuse; wanting to stay at Dart's side. Unfortunately, because of Sandora's use of the feared Dragon, Albert must admit that she is not safe within Indels either and things are looking grim for his country.
Dart will then inquire with Minister Noish on what he knows about the Black Monster. Very little is known, beside the fact it seemed to appear after the Dragon Campaign. You'll then be treated to a voiced-over movie where Noish tells the party about the history of the Dragon Campaign. Afterwards, a war meeting will commence with Shana going out to the balcony, leaving Dart by himself. In the throne room, you can exit to the northeast to find a shady-looking, black-robed man in Albert's chambers. There's a neat escape slide you can use descend to the second floor of the Castle, too.
Find Shana out on the balcony to the south of the throne room and they'll talk about Seles. Lavitz will come in and assure the two that everybody in Seles is doing okay and they are beginning to rebuild. Unfortunately, he is being sent to the town of Hoax to prepare a defense against the impending attack of the Dragon. Dart, along with Shana, will then be resolved to put off his search for the Black Monster in order to fight against Sandora and the Dargon alongside Lavitz. Our next destination is the town of Hoax, but there is still more to do within Bale; including stopping by Lavitz's home.
Make your way back to the entrance of Bale, and for an extra scene, attempt to leave town without visiting Lavitz's house. Now, descend the stairs near the entrance to enter the path underneath the fountain. There's a drunkard, Dran, here and he'll move out of the way if Dart gives him the Good Spirits he purchased at the bar. Unfortunately, this item will leave your inventory, and there's no way to keep it without forfeiting all of the treasures that are beyond.
With Dran out of the way, we can explore the aqueducts of Bale and Indels Castle. Climb the stairs past Dran, then the passageway behind the inn, to emerge in an underground section. There are multiple paths: one leading to a chest with 20 Gold inside, another placing you underneath the bazaar, where there is nothing to be gained, then the exit to the north that takes you to the dock area that was underneath Indels Castle. Having turned the wheel inside the Castle, Dart can climb the ladder on the left-side of the port to a chest hoarding 20 more Gold, then descend and use the boat the navigate through the aqueducts.
Have Dart stop at the first, and only, landing area and search the wine casks inside the cellar to find yet another piece of Stardust. Hop back on the boat to return to the port area and the main street of Bale.
This time, use the exit beside the item shop to enter Slambert Plaza. Search the well to acquire another Stardust piece, then enter Lavitz's home to the north.
The trio is greeted by Lavitz's widowed mother inside his home. His mom will think that Lavitz has brought Shana back as his bride and Dart will have a choice on how to respond. If you pick the first: Dart will confirm that Shana is his girlfriend, while the second he will feign ignorance and make a joke out of things. Either way, Lavitz's mom and Shana will go to the kitchen to make lunch, leaving Dart to explore.
Follow them into the kitchen and search the cabinet of dinnerware near where they are cooking to pick up your seventh piece of Stardust. You can also pocket another 20 Gold in a chest in the lower storage room.
Talk to Lavitz in the living room to be presented a number of options to pass the time while the ladies cook. Make sure to select them all, with a tour of the house being saved for last, for some humorous conversation. Afterwards, you can visit the various rooms to learn more about Lavitz and his family, but to advance the story, you need to visit the study on the second floor. Lavitz will maneuver a ladder allowing him and Dart access the rooftop overlooking Indels Castle. He'll tell Dart about his childhood and dream of becoming a knight like his father and defending the country. After lunch, talk to Lavitz's mother again and tell her that you are ready to leave to end up staying the night for a free rest.
Back in control of Dart, use the ladder in Lavitz's study to climb back out to the rooftops. Use the action icon on the right-side to jump over into the barn next door. Dart will have to walk a narrow beam to make it to the other side. It's fairly simple, just make sure to hit X each time the action icon is prompted for Dart to regain his balance. On the other side, open the chest containing a Healing Breeze. This item acts like a Healing Potion for the entire party.
